While traveling and studying in  Senegal, Bianca Griffith, Sante Natural’s president,  became involved in a small village called Mbam where she worked with a village doctor named Ndiouma to document the regions medicinal plants. She discovered that even though Ndiouma treated between 30 and 40 patients a day during the wet season, he worked out of a small earth room with no windows. This simple hut was not only his “clinic” but also his bedroom which he shared with his brother. Inspired by his work and with her new found appreciation for traditional medicine she raised money and used it to build the region’s first traditional health clinic.
